    2. Hi Shirley - I saw your response to my posting to Betty on Jeremiah Webb. You may not recall, but you were nice enough to send me your list of Webbs a couple of weeks ago. I am descended from Meredith E. Webb as well through his son Jefferson. Jefferson's son John Henry Webb b. 11-8-1873 is my great-great-grandfather. This is completely unsubstantiated but since receiving your list, I found a Rootsweb Message Board posting by a Donald Jamison that stated he is in possession of a family record of John Galvin Webb b. about 1690 in Wales. This family record claims that John Galvin Webb, his wife (unknown name) and children emigrated to America in 1722. All 5 of his sons served in the Revolutionary War which are the following: John Webb Jr. m. Elizabeth Corbin Benjamin Webb William Webb Henry Webb Lucius Webb The family record (as cited from the message board posting) goes on to say that John Webb and Elizabeth Corbin who are believed to have been married and died in Blount Co., TN had the following children: Jeremiah Webb John Webb Meredith Burton Webb Millie Webb Rosanna Webb Based on the hypothesis of this family record, you can understand my question to Betty if the bible records or other documents she had, confirmed that Meredith Burton Webb's father was Jeremiah Webb of Kentucky. I have not had the opportunity yet, but when I get the chance, I am going to try to track down this family record that I stated above and see I can get a copy of it. Maybe this individual has documents as well that can either prove or disprove. I wish my ancestor could have been named something else other than John Webb. Might as well have been John Smith. Until then, Webb Cousin, I am in search of a John Webb whose son was Meredith E. Webb. Have you ever found out what the "E" stands for? Have a good day, Lisa Webb Dodson Houston, TX

    3. Lisa - Sorry, I didn't make the connection - glad you got the info I sent. Can you tell me who Earl Webb is that wrote the history of the Webbs and how to get a copy. I've been off the list for a while but when I was told a discussion had started on Jeremiah Webb, I thought I'd better get back on. No one seems to know what the "E" in Meredith E. Webb stands for. Does anyone know of a Anthony Webb or a Webb mother with a maiden name of Anthony. Meredith's oldest son was named Anthony - trying all the angles. Right now we've been leaning towards a John Webb married to a Sarah as Meredith's father. We have a copy of a legal document dated 13 Dec 1838 where a couple of men say that after being duly sworn, they have proceeded to set apart much of the crops and provisions on hand to last Sarah and her family for a year. It lists a Sarah Webb as widow of John Webb. The final inventory was taken in Feb 1839. Our Meredith lands in Shelby County, Texas with a date of emigration almost to the month a year later, Apr 1840 and his witnesses are Sarah Webb and W. K. Myrick. This John Webb could probably be a brother of Meredith Burton Webb. Incidentally, our Meredith was born in 1803 in NC with a father born in NC and a mother born in Germany.
